About this role
Strategy Associate Santa Clara, CA or Remote Thanks for your interest in Oklo! We are searching for a Strategy Associate to join our team. Position Description Oklo is seeking a Strategy Associate to support the Chief Strategy Officer and senior leadership across the company's strategy and commercial functions. This role sits at the center of Oklo's most important initiatives, including power deployment, fuel strategy, capital formation, and strategic partnerships. You will work directly with the CSO to drive execution across high-priority workstreams. This role is designed for someone with strong analytical rigor and execution ability, who can operate across a broad set of problems and bring structure to complex, fast-moving initiatives. Specific responsibilities may include: - Support the CSO and senior leadership (including commercial and technical leaders) on core strategic priorities across power, fuel, and infrastructure deployment - Drive execution across key initiatives - Prepare materials for executive leadership, investors, partners, and Board discussions - Conduct market research and synthesize insights across energy markets, datacenter demand, government policy, and nuclear infrastructure - Coordinate cross-functional efforts across commercial, finance, legal, regulatory, and engineering teams - Identify bottlenecks and execution risks across projects and drive resolution - Act as a force multiplier for leadership by improving clarity, alignment, and execution across initiatives Minimum Qualifications: - 2-5 years of experience in investment banking, management consulting, private equity, or similar analytical roles - Experience building high-quality materials for senior stakeholders (e.g., investors, executives, Board) - Ability to manage multiple workstreams in a fast-paced, high-ownership
